Scope and Contents

The AKC Event Rules and Regulations Collection consists of official rules, regulations, policies, procedures, and related publications governing American Kennel Club events and competitions. The collection documents the development, administration, and standardization of AKC-sanctioned events from the early twentieth century to the present.

Materials include rule books, policy manuals, procedural guides, judges’ and stewards’ manuals, registration requirements, and event-specific regulations issued and revised by the American Kennel Club.

The collection is arranged by event category and discipline. Publications are generally arranged chronologically within subseries and described at the item level.

Historical Note

The first complete book of rules regarding registration and dog shows was approved by the delegates and published by the AKC in 1932. Since then, the AKC has provided published rules, regulations, and procedures applying to the various dog sports. As rules are updated, the AKC publishes replacement pamphlets, numbering in the tens of thousands each year, to keep participants up-to-date.

Source: The American Kennel Club 1884-1984: A Source Book

Abstract

This collection consists of pamphlets containing rules, regulations, and guidelines dating from the 1930s to the present. The materials are arranged into seven series by topic. Within each subseries, pamphlets are organized chronologically and described at the item level.
